I know it is cliche, but everyone has their favorite show. The show that they binge watch on Netflix for hours and hours. The show they probably have at least one merchandise product from. Whether its a comedy like The Big Bang Theory or Modern Family or a drama like Criminal Minds or CSI, everyone has that one show they favor. I am going to talk about how that favorite show affects us.

Personally, NCIS is the show I binge watch on Netflix. I have seen every episode of the thirteen seasons and continue watching the new episodes coming out weekly with Season 14. For any show, after so long of watching it, you feel the emotions the characters feel and think the way the characters do. You become a part of the show to a certain extent.

For example, the way Mark Harmon (Gibbs) plays a father figure to his team. Or the way Ziva, McGee, Dinozzo, and Abby are like siblings. Even the director of NCIS has a more personal friendship than just being a boss to them all. Then there is the way that coworkers are not suppose to date but that rule gets violated. Tony and Ziva end up with a child. McGee and Abby have dated in the past and still flirt. And Palmer and special agent Lee have that fling for a while.

There are all of Gibbs favorite rules and things that I have started following in life. Trust your gut, its always right is probably the biggest one. Then there is Rule #51: Sometimes- You're wrong. And Rule #42: Never accept an apology from someone who just sucker punched you. And Rule #8: Never take anything for granted.

Its not just my favorite TV show; it has taught me things that I now apply to my everyday life.
